Leprosy is a debilitating, infectious and contagious disease that can appear up to 10 years after infection. In the ESF, nursing is part of the collective work process and is directly involved in the periodic monitoring of leprosy, prevention, search for the disease, patient follow-up, management of control activities, registration systems and surveillance of periodic contacts. We sought to carry out a survey to identify the importance of nursing care in the face of leprosy. Methodology: This is a narrative, descriptive and exploratory literature review, with a qualitative approach, carried out through a bibliographical research. Data were collected from the SciELO, VHL and Google Scholar platforms. Results and discussions: Leprosy is a chronic disease with a high disabling power. Brazil has the second highest leprosy rate in the world. Although the numbers are high, Primary Care, through the SUS, promotes diagnostic and treatment strategies for the disease free of charge. Nurses are the most active professionals in the general care of patients in Primary Care, and assume a prominent role in the face of leprosy, through the nursing consultation, where they perform direct care and guide the patient to self-care, building a bond of trust, reducing treatment dropout rates. Final considerations: Nursing care has great relevance in the diagnosis and treatment of leprosy, with nurses being a fundamental agent within Primary Care.
